A cluster of street-side stalls and small shops on the slopes below The Ridge where Tibetan traders sell carpets, metal-bead jewellery, prayer flags, woollen clothing, and curios. The market is part of the wider network of Tibetan refugee commerce that has established itself across Indian hill stations, and Shimla's version is a compact but well-stocked stop for those looking for Tibetan handicrafts and woollens at negotiable prices.
